Grado, Administrative municipality in Asturias, Spain
Grado is a municipality in Asturias spanning green valleys and mountainous terrain. The town center houses administrative facilities that serve the local population.
Grado gained administrative importance through its integration with neighboring areas in the broader Asturian system. Regional cooperation shaped how the municipality developed and functioned over time.
The place takes its name from the Latin word for step, reflecting its geography. Local traditions shape everyday life here through regional festivals and food customs that residents practice throughout the year.

Location: Province of Asturias
Capital city: Grau
Part of: Mancomunidad de los Concejos de Grado y Yernes y Tameza
Shares border with: Candamu, Les Regueres, Proaza, Santo Adriano, Oviedo, Teberga, Yernes y Tameza, Belmonte de Miranda, Salas
Website: http://ayto-grado.es
GPS coordinates: 43.38943,-6.06869
